Output 35cbf83f4292eccd8475b6d4e53931f88b81b449c009f457fd2024b1487886e3:3

value
19609983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 938c92edd3dce932e118f8df6829131e267d56d5 OP_EQUAL
address
MMMKxssf2QE6k4YXhoooCzVDNL2dFvPE4R
transaction
35cbf83f4292eccd8475b6d4e53931f88b81b449c009f457fd2024b1487886e3
spent
true